RE: Initialisation
Bonjour Hamet,
Tu peux soit :
- Lancer une trace de nuit avec le SQL Profiler (notemment avec les bons
events TSQL) et en filtrant sur ta base. Tu auras ainsi l'ensemble de toutes
opérations SQL de nuit qui impactent ta base et ta table.
- De façon plus fine, tu peux créer d'une part une table T_Traces, et
d'autre part un trigger sur ta table en question dont les valeurs datetime se
remettent à NULL, de tel sorte que sur un UPDATE de ton champ DateTime tu
insères une entrée dans ta table T_Traces pour flager l'origine (user, heure
exacte de la modif, exécution d'un sp_blockerxx, etc..)
Fred.M.
"Hamet" a écrit :
> Bonjour
>
> J'ai une champ datetime pour toutes les lignes d'une table qui se met à Null
> chaque nuit. Je ne sait pas d'ou cela vient. Comment le savoir ? (Log,
> espion).
> Comment puis-je savoir ce qui modifie ce champ pour toutes les ligne de ma
> table ?
>
> Merci
|